SULFUR INFO

  • Chemical Formula- S8
  • Color- Yellow to Yellow Brown
  • Streak- White
  • Hardness- 1.5 - 2.5
  • Specific Gravity- 2.0 - 2.1

SULFUR INFO

  • Luster- adamantine on clean, crystal surfaces, otherwise dull.
  • Crystal Shape- Orthorhombic
  • Cleavage- None
  • Fracture- Conchoidal
  • Location on Where it is Found- Near Volcanoes, hot springs, rotten eggs, etc.

SULFUR INFO

  • Transparency- Can be transparent to opaque
  • Class- Sulfur Polymorph group
  • Mineral Group- Native elements; non metallic elements
  • What has it been used for- sulfuric acids, fertilizer, gunpowder, sulfur compounds, etc.
